Backup: don't do copy-on-read in before_write_notifier
authorWen Congyang <wency@cn.fujitsu.com>
Tue, 8 Sep 2015 03:28:33 +0000 (11:28 +0800)
committerJeff Cody <jcody@redhat.com>
Fri, 25 Sep 2015 12:37:07 +0000 (08:37 -0400)
commit06c3916b35a1cf6db548450a0cfb96983c33c82f
tree25f33565d45bed4614ba63dbfc361f74ff153a13
parent9568b511c9f91c3d21ea3e83426d4ee7168c98bb
Backup: don't do copy-on-read in before_write_notifier

We will copy data in before_write_notifier to do backup.
It is a nested I/O request, so we cannot do copy-on-read.

The steps to reproduce it:
1. -drive copy-on-read=on,...  // qemu option
2. drive_backup -f disk0 /path_to_backup.img // monitor command

Signed-off-by: Wen Congyang <wency@cn.fujitsu.com>
Tested-by: Jeff Cody <jcody@redhat.com>
Message-id: 1441682913-14320-3-git-send-email-wency@cn.fujitsu.com
Signed-off-by: Jeff Cody <jcody@redhat.com>
block/backup.c